Well for me, the hardest part is getting started.
If something really needs to get done and you have no patience to do it, put a limit on it. Like set a timer for ten minutes, clean and when the timer rings, take a five minute break. Then set it again. Or, if you only had ten spare minutes in the first place, you're ten minutes closer to an organized home.
It also helps to organize it into chunks. I decide to do just five things, for example 1. Put away shoes 2. Pick up toys etc. Usually by the time I finish, I'm all revved up and ready to do five more things. And if I'm not, again I've at least done something.

| Buy a pack of circled color coded stickers. Label each room in your new house with a color. Put that color sticker on the box that will go into that room. When the movers bring the boxes, you just direct them to the right color room.

Don't throw random stuff into the same box- make sure they are packed according to final destination (room), as well as specific place (top drawer, etc).
Label boxes according to room, and what is in them.
Once you make the move, don't let yourself hide unpacked boxes in closets. Keep them out so they annoy you every time you pass, and you'll be a lot more motivated to unpack quickly.
If packing or unpacking overwhelm you, set limits- I will un/pack 3 boxes, then I get a break. Make it manageable.

I use tons of clear covered boxes from the container store. Every type of item gets an appropriate size box. The toys are sotred in these boxes too. I use them in the living room for cds and for office supplies. They stack well on shelves or in a closed sloset. It is also easy to see and find whats inside.
This may seem obvious but each type of item should be in only one place in the house. For example any hardware should all be found in the same container or drawer - if you find a loose screw around you always know where to put it, similarly you'll know where to find the hammer when you find it. A container full of haribows, and one full of gifts I never used that can be recycled. etc..
